Mark 5:22 Cross References - Geneva

22 And beholde, there came one of the rulers of the Synagogue, whose name was Iairus: and when he sawe him, he fell downe at his feete,

Luke 8:41-56

41 And beholde, there came a man named Iairus, and he was the ruler of the Synagogue, who fell downe at Iesus feete, and besought him that he would come into his house. 42 For he had but a daughter onely, about twelue yeeres of age, and she lay a dying (and as he went, the people thronged him. 43 And a woman hauing an yssue of blood, twelue yeeres long, which had spent all her substance vpon physicians, and could not be healed of any: 44 When she came behind him, she touched the hemme of his garment, and immediatly her yssue of blood stanched. 45 Then Iesus sayd, Who is it that hath touched me? When euery man denied, Peter sayd and they that were with him, Master, the multitude thrust thee, and tread on thee, and sayest thou, Who hath touched me? 46 And Iesus sayde, Some one hath touched me: for I perceiue that vertue is gone out of me. 47 When the woman sawe that she was not hid, she came trembling, and fell downe before him, and tolde him before all the people, for what cause she had touched him, and how she was healed immediatly. 48 And he said vnto her, Daughter, be of good comfort: thy faith hath saued thee: go in peace.) 49 While he yet spake, there came one from the ruler of the Synagogues house, which sayde to him, Thy daughter is dead: disease not the Master. 50 When Iesus heard it, he answered him, saying, Feare not: beleeue onely, and she shall be saued. 51 And when he went into the house, he suffered no man to goe in with him, saue Peter, and Iames, and Iohn, and the father and mother of the maide. 52 And all wept, and sorowed for her: but he sayd, Weepe not: for she is not dead, but sleepeth. 53 And they laught him to scorne, knowing that she was dead. 54 So he thrust them all out, and tooke her by the hand, and cryed, saying, Maide, arise. 55 And her spirite came againe, and she rose straightway: and he comanded to giue her meate. 56 Then her parents were astonied: but hee commanded them that they should tell no man what was done.
